A 23-year-old man and a 62-year-old man suffering from cystinuria underwent extracorporeal shock wave lithotripsy (ESWL) for right renal stone and left ureteral stone, respectively. They had double-J stents placed before ESWL, but since attempts to retrieve the stents were unsuccessful due to encrustation, they were referred to our clinic. Multimodal endourologic and open approaches including ESWL, transurethral ureterolithotripsy, and pyelolithotomy were required to render them stent- and stone-free. The guidelines do not recommend routine stenting before ESWL ; therefore, the indication and duration of indwelling stents should be minimized. Multimodal options including not only ESWL and endoscopic surgery but also open surgery, should be attempted for the management of encrusted stents. Close monitoring and follow up are important to the prevent complications of ureteral stents.

A 70-year-old man visited a urological clinic on May 2008 complaining of dysuria and nocturia since 2 years prior. He was diagnosed as having gross benign prostatic hypertrophy, and was referred to a nearby hospital for transurethral resection of prostate (TURP). During TURP, a papillary tumor was found in the prostatic urethra on the left side and a biopsy was performed. A pathological examination revealed urothelial carcinoma G3. Cystoprostatectomy was planned, but the patient refused the procedure. Therefore, he underwent three courses of MVAC intra-arterial chemotherapy (methotrexate, vinblastin, doxorubicin, cisplatinum) at our hospital. After chemotherapy, no tumor was found in the prostatic urethra and a pathological report of repeat TUR showed no tumor. Currently, the patient is alive and there has been no evidence of recurrence for 1 year and 10 month.

Previous studies have demonstrated that carbonate apatite (CA) is superior to hydroxyapatite (HA) and ß-tricalciumphosphate (ß-TCP) with regard to osteoclastic resorption, but evidence on osteoclast and osteoblast response remains controversial. In the present study, the expression of bone related mRNA is examined on CA, HA, ß-TCP, and titanium plates. ICR mouse osteoblast cells are cocultured with ICR mouse bone marrow cells. Crude osteoclast-like cell-rich suspensions are then seeded onto plates and cultured for 48 h. Total RNA is extracted and mRNA expression is examined by real-time RT-PCR. Amounts of vacuolar-type ATPase, cathepsin K, and TRAP mRNA are significantly greater on CA than on the other plates. The amount of osteoprotegerin mRNA is significantly greater on CA than on the other plates. RANKL mRNA expression, which is generally regarded as an osteoblast maker, varies with material, but shows no significant differences between CA and the other plates. The formation and activity of osteoclasts is greater with CA than with the other plates. Thus, CA is superior to ß-TCP as a bioresorbable bone substitute for tissue engineering.

Porous blocks of carbonate apatite (CA) were prepared by holding together CA particles ranging in size from 300 to 500 microm through sintering at 750 degrees C for 2 hours. Bone marrow cells taken from Fischer rats were seeded onto and inside the CA blocks and cultured for 14 days to allow stem cells to proliferate to osteoblasts capable of inducing bone formation. Hybrids made of CA blocks and cultured bone marrow cells were then implanted into the back of syngeneic rats. Microfocus x-ray computed tomographic images of tissues containing CA blocks before decalcification suggested that new bone was formed in this extraosseous site 4 and 8 weeks after implantation. These data indicate that the hybrid made of CA and bone marrow cells is capable of inducing heterotopic bone formation in vivo.

Human papilloma virus (HPV) has been recently proposed to be implicated in the development of head and neck squamous cell carcinoma (HNSCC) in patients without cancer risk. We examined the expression of HPV16/18 E6/E7 in 71 cases of HNSCCs and investigated abnormalities of the p53 gene in 62 of these 71 cases. Expression of HPV16 E6/E7 was observed in 11 of the 71 cases (15.5%), while expression of HPV18 E6/E7 was not observed in any of the cases. Most of the HPV16 E6/E7-positive cases were histopathologically characterized by their verrucous or papillary structure and koilocytosis of the adjacent mucosa. There was no clear relationship between expression of HPV16 E6/E7 and tumor stage, prognosis or the positive rate of p53 abnormality. These results suggest that approximately 15% of HNSCCs are caused by HPV16 infection and the subsequent constitutive expression of E6 and E7, and that some HPV-initiated tumors lose their original characteristics during tumor progression.

TGF-beta-stimulated clone-22 (TSC-22) was reported to be a differentiation-inducing factor which negatively regulates the growth of salivary gland cancer cells. In the present study, we examined the expression of TSC-22 in salivary gland tumors by immunohistochemistry. In pleomorphic adenoma (PA), most of the sparse myoepithelial-like tumor cells, which are considered as the differentiated cells because they produce extracellular matrix, expressed TSC-22. However, only a limited number of cases of the solid myoepithelial-like tumor cells in PA, which are considered as the growing cells, expressed TSC-22. In adenoid cystic carcinoma (ACC), inner ductal cells in the tubular structure, strongly expressed TSC-22, though the outer myoepithelial-like tumor cells did not express TSC-22. In the cribriform structure, myoepithelial-like tumor cells did not express TSC-22. However, a small ductal structure in the micro-cyst wall strongly expressed TSC-22. Sparse type myoepithelial-like tumor cells in ACC also expressed TSC-22. In mucoepidermoid carcinoma, epidermoid tumor cells and mucous-producing tumor cells in mucoepidermoid carcinoma frequently expressed TSC-22. Thus, the expression of TSC-22 was frequently observed in the cells with differentiated-phenotypes, although rarely in the cells with growing potentials. These results suggest that TSC-22 may play an important role in maintaining the differentiated phenotype in salivary gland tumors.

Bone apatite contains carbonate and is therefore not pure hydroxyapatite. We have successfully developed sintered carbonate apatite (CA) with a concentration of carbonate of 6 weight% and have evaluated its osteoconductive and bioresorption characteristics. Cylindrical porous sintered CA and sintered hydroxyapatite (HA) measuring 4 x 4 mm with a porosity of 20% were implanted into surgically-created bone defects in the knees of rabbits. The animals were killed after 1, 3, 6 and 12 months. The defects were evaluated by microfocus CT and histology. Bone growth into and around both materials increased. Newly-formed bone was placed in direct contact with both. Osteoclast-like cells resorbed only CA, and were coupled with osteoblasts. The porosity of sintered CA increased, indicating bioresorption, whereas that of sintered HA did not increase. Our findings indicate that sintered CA may be useful as a bioresorbable bone substitute.
